Understanding the 2022 Bronco Upfitter Switches
The 2022 Bronco Upfitter Switches are a factory-installed feature designed to simplify the integration of aftermarket accessories. Essentially, they provide dedicated, pre-wired circuits that you can tap into. This eliminates the need to run complex wiring directly from the battery for every new device. The system is designed with a built-in relay and fuse protection, meaning your vehicle's sensitive electronics are safeguarded from power surges or incorrect wiring. The importance of understanding the 2022 Bronco Upfitter Switches Wiring Diagram cannot be overstated for a clean, reliable, and safe installation.
There are typically four upfitter switches provided, each offering a distinct power output. These circuits are conveniently located in a dedicated panel, often near the dashboard, for easy access. When you activate a switch, it completes a circuit, allowing power to flow from the vehicle's electrical system to the connected accessory. The wiring diagram will show you which circuits are available, their amperage ratings, and how to connect your accessories without interfering with the Bronco's existing functions. Some common uses include:
- Auxiliary lighting (spotlights, light bars)
- Winches
- Air compressors
- Communications equipment (CB radios)
- Power for specialized tools
The 2022 Bronco Upfitter Switches Wiring Diagram provides crucial details for a successful installation. It outlines the following key information:
- Circuit Identification: Each switch is labeled, and the diagram will clearly show which specific circuit it controls.
- Amperage Ratings: Knowing the maximum amperage each circuit can handle is vital for selecting the correct fuse and ensuring you don't overload the system.
- Wire Colors and Gauge: The diagram specifies the color and gauge of the wires for each upfitter circuit, making connections straightforward.
- Power Source: It details where the power originates within the Bronco's electrical system.
